On April 17 2011 11:42 Nemireck wrote:
Show nested quote +
On April 17 2011 09:18 aust1nz wrote:
Nemireck -- that's a really interesting and, in my mind, valid point. However, for those of us who are never going to play Starcraft BEYOND ladder play, I think this build provides an interesting alternative, especially in the ZvP matchup.

That said, would it make sense for a pro to have this build in their back pockets for an unorthodox play style when ahead?


That's also a fair and valid point. For ladder play, this build is probably really solid (I'm going to be practicing it myself to see how it feels). But when pros post their criticisms, they have no choice but to judge the build based on what they know ACTUALLY works at the top levels of play, and it's good that they can come into these threads and point out the general weaknesses for those players that DO aspire to be the best, and not just become good, solid, ladder players.


I think i have even said in a post before that people in lower leagues (or even low-mid masters) will probably have more success with this build than the build they used before. For this i see two reasons: a) the build they used before was worse than this build; b) they lacked experience for the build they used before.

The thing is, spanishiwa gives you an overall gameplan and buildorder and a buildorder that fits to that gameplan. Most people here have probably never had such a thing as a gameplan and a buildorder that goes above 15-20 supply (from coaching people i know that ;p). Now if you are able to execute the build order he has given you, you are already a better player than anyone else in your league, just because the other people arent able to execute their buildorder and have no gameplan.

The reason why i am critizing this build all the time is, that once you rise in the leagues at some point, this build order will give you some trouble.

Imagine you have made it to the grandmaster league. Then you get your next laddermatch and its our friendly italian cloud. lets assume he just builds 1 rax at the bottom of the ramp on xel naga caverns. you have to be instantly concerned that a second baracks was proxied somewhere. so you better make like 2 crawlers at your natural minimum. turns out he is just going 1 rax CC and then immidiately into blueflame with just 1 rax. no bunkers (typical cloud :D). he then proceeds to poke around a little with hellions (killing creeptumors that are planted out of range of the crawlers) while going for double ebay and siegetank tech and getting a relatively quick third commandcenter. i dont want to go too much into detail as cloud has an important match against zerg coming up, but i can tell you that you're in quite some trouble if you have zergling speed finished as late as 80-90 supply.

Especially in lower leagues, people play so many allins, and allins is what this build is great against (better than the way i play, i will freely admit!). the thing is just, that when you play against a greedy fuck like cloud (sorry i have to take you as an example again cloud :D), you cannot only be worried about all the random allins, but also about what you are going to do when your opponent sees that you get super late gas and stationary defense and just goes super super greedy. In the lower leagues you dont have people who play like this, because of all the allins that are being played, but the higher you get, you will encounter people who play like this more often, or play like this as a reaction to scouting no gas + stationary defense.

On April 17 2011 05:55 themell wrote:
Show nested quote +
On April 17 2011 03:39 truthless wrote:
On April 17 2011 02:43 Whitewing wrote:
On April 17 2011 02:24 truthless wrote:
I watched the day9 daily and I fail to be convinced that a DT rush cannot kill this, or at the very least, do significant damage to it which would allow you to clean it up with straight up zealots and archons afterwards.

Starting out with a typical 3gate sentry expand BO, you can easily decide to skip the sentries as soon as you scout it and transition into a hidden council+dark shrine in some corner of the map unlikely to be scouted, spend all your WG cooldowns on getting zealots (which will shred the no-speed zerglings) and will easily allow you to take your natural just like your typical 3gate expand (maybe a teensy bit later).

Have your scouting probe drop a pylon in a decent spot and your DTs should arrive no later than 7:30 (probably upwards 30 sec before then, if you get a good proxy pylon) at his ramp, at which point he should have no more than 4 queens. Even if he's blocking the ramp with two of them your 3+ DTs will rip through that in a matter of seconds. I believe it takes 4 hits to kill a queen. They won't have energy to transfuse more than once or twice each. If you're not up that ramp 10-15 sec after you arrive I'd be massively surprised.

Spanishiwa dropped his evos and started his lair tech at like 8:00 in the first game. Granted, he saw a lot of sentries, so he didn't need to worry about templar tech, but I just don't see how he can possibly hold off a DT rush without being forced to either take gas earlier and go lair tech, or drop his first evo a full minute earlier and drop several spore crawlers, at which point you simply back off with your DTs, use all your gas to make archons, and hit a hard 6gate timing with zealots+archons. All he'll have is spinecrawlers and zerglings.


Thing is, you poke often to see what they have, and if you only see zealots, you can expect either A) stargate play or B) DT rush. If you see mostly zealots, you just plop down that evo chamber early.

The issue with that is you have no idea if it's phoenix or DTs. Which means you need to drop down more than just the evo chamber. You need like 3 spores I'd say to fully protect your main, natural and front, which is 4 less drones and 12 less zerglings, just from hiding tech. Not only that but you won't be able to grab a third or threaten the protoss at all until you get an overseer out (if it's DTs), which means protoss is likely to get a third before you.

Those DTs aren't wasted either, even if you get the read off and build detectors before they arrive. Archons are amazing against zerglings, which is all the zerg will have until like 9th or 10th minute except spinecrawlers. A 2base timing push with 6gates and pretty much nothing but zealots and archons should crush through. But it's such an odd strategy that I doubt we'll see much of it.

I just think people are mainly reacting poorly to this build since it's so different and new. People are very uncomfortable expanding fast against zerg without proper protection like sentries or a fast forge, so they end up being behind. You can basically go 1gate expand into 6gate+council and be perfectly safe when you scout it. But that's pretty much unheard of against zerg.


I hope you aren't serious. You only need one spore at nat and main. Queens will handle any air. Lings or queens will handle any dts. And a quick protoss third? I don't see how a fast third can survive if scouted. This build allows for fast transition into an aggressive build due to the heavy eco focus early on.

And you only need an overseer when the dts are spotted or tech spotted. The spore will give enough vision, especially since zergs don't have a lot of buildings to build. 6 gate timing push could work, but I don't see how well that would work after a failed dt rush.

Ugh, stop theorycrafting. There are already players in tournaments using this strategy nonstop. Even their opponents know the zerg is using it, but still can't stop it. Yes, you can go one gate expand into 6gate + council, but you're going to be far behind the zerg eco because you apply no pressure.


A single DT can kill the spines at the front if you don't protect them with vision. A bit map dependant, since nats are at different locations from your ramp, but that's why I said 3. It all depends on how far from your minerals your spines are, since a voidray can easily outrange a spore that's placed on the other side of the hatchery.

The timing push I implied would include the DTs (but as Archons), since the zergs army will be mostly zerglings at that point, they'll do really well. I've yet to see anyone execute this, and I haven't run into the build yet on ladder myself, so I can't do much more than theorycraft. Sorry.

Oh, and the safe 3rd was implied as a double expand when the protoss typically takes his natural, under the protection of DTs. Since overseers won't be out until 8:30 or so at the earliest you have a good 2 minutes where your expansion can't really be threatened without the zerg giving up drones (to make enough lings to overwhelm) and some lings that'll have to die. Even if he kills the 3rd, just by making those lings instead of drones you've managed to apply enough pressure to cancel out his early economic lead.

But, as I said, neither of those two strategies have really been tried properly, I feel. Correct me if wrong though. I'd love to see some replays with similar builds being used.

Long-time lurker, fairly new poster, but I have to state that I do very much enjoy this style of Zerg and the play that it represents. Mostly because I've always been a bit of a macro whore player to begin with.

While DarkForce and the like being up very valid flaws with the ceding of map control, at the same time, I'm wondering how much of that is underestimation of large amount of Queen play. There have been games on the stream where Spanishiwa has mass produced Queens to hold off against tons of early aggression. While certainly some builds will exploit the flaws in this general build order, I'm wondering how much good Queen play and slight, knowing modifications to the build order would compensate for that.

I think that if you take the build order as is, 100% of the time, there are key flaws. But perhaps consider this more of an opening to be expanded upon as necessary. If you scout something that dictates and earlier Ling speed, throw down two extractors earlier and get the speed before lair tech. Alternatively, if for some reason you need lair tech earlier, same thing with Lair tech.

Overall, I anticipate that this build is very robust, and while certainly is not the be all end all of Zerg play, certainly has the potential to become a fairly safe and standard build in general. I don't think you'd want to use it every game of a BoX match, but it still gives you lots of options, lots of potential, and does have a slight benefit to holding teching long enough to get a good idea of what the opponent is up to, with proper scouting technique.

On that note, joining in with the "please stop flaming the pros." Seriously? They post valuable content to the forums because they feel like it. Don't jump to conclusions like: "they lost a game not using Spanishiwa therefore Spanishiwa is better." It hurts my mathematician soul.
